It sounds really easy to say that but over time we had slowly become slaves to plastics. Plastic bags, disposable plastic containers, plastic wraps, microwaveable plastics and so on. I admit plastics are so convenient and make life easier. We had been plastic junkies and had stocked up so much of everything plastic and so the move away was difficult but we are moving away now.<\/span><\/div>\n<div align=\"justify\"><span style=\"font-family:times new roman;\"><br \/><\/span><\/div>\n<div align=\"justify\"><span style=\"font-family:times new roman;\">Off with all the disposable plastic boxes, yogurt bottles and stuff and in with the old stainless steel <span class=\"blsp-spelling-error\">dabbas<\/span> and glass\/ceramic containers. We bought in a bunch of glass bowls to store food in the fridge and trashed a big chunk of our plastics into the recycle bin. Of course these glass bowls do not have a tight-fitting lids but I am back to the good old stainless steel plates to cover up my bowls. The pantry still has quite a lot of plastic bottles filled with all kinds of lentils and spices. We do want to make a move towards some alternative methods of air-tight, bug-free storage.<\/span><\/div>\n<div align=\"justify\"><span style=\"font-family:times new roman;\"><br \/><\/span><\/div>\n<div align=\"justify\"><span style=\"font-family:times new roman;\">With regards to plastic bags, we have literally started carrying our bags to grocery stores like we did in those days. Saying no to plastic and paper bags offered at the stores. It is a habit we need to form. A little tough. We have a cloth bag in each of our cars and <span class=\"blsp-spelling-error\">everytime<\/span> we stop we try to carry in our bags and get it filled. Again a small way to reduce the use of plastics. Plastics are basically petroleum based products and are non-biodegradable. And it does lead to environmental concerns that we are not aware of and not bothered about <span class=\"blsp-spelling-error\">coz<\/span> it really does not affect us directly. One such thing I learned during my research about plastic is about the North Pacific <span class=\"blsp-spelling-error\">Gyre<\/span>.<\/span><\/div>\n<div align=\"justify\"><span style=\"font-family:times new roman;\"><br \/><\/span><\/div>\n<div align=\"justify\"><span style=\"font-family:times new roman;\">The North Pacific <span class=\"blsp-spelling-error\">Gyre<\/span> is a vortex of ocean currents in the Pacific Ocean. The vortex motion, draws in waste matter and marine <span class=\"blsp-spelling-corrected\">debris<\/span> which decompose over time and form the food for the tiny <span class=\"blsp-spelling-corrected\">plankton<\/span> that thrive in those seas. It is also called the Garbage Patch and the Pacific Trash Vortex because of its nature.<\/span><\/div>\n<div align=\"justify\"><span style=\"font-family:times new roman;\"><br \/><\/span><\/div>\n<div align=\"justify\"><span style=\"font-family:times new roman;\">It is now becoming a plastic dump and <span class=\"blsp-spelling-error\">ofcourse<\/span> as plastic does not degrade it is causing big issues that are underworld. The plastic dump is supposed to be twice the size of Texas and extend from Hawaii to Japan.
